Hiring an Environment & Release Specialist to manage complex end-to-end environments and coordinate large-scale releases across applications and infrastructure. This role focuses on enhancing CI/CD processes, ensuring stability of Non-Production Environments, and aligning technical solutions with both project and BAU needs through close collaboration with stakeholders.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and implement strategies for effective environment management, ensuring that all environments are maintained at optimal performance levels.
  • Oversee the deployment of new releases, ensuring that all changes are thoroughly tested and validated before implementation.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to identify and resolve any issues that may arise during the release process.
  • Continuously improve release processes to enhance efficiency and reduce the risk of errors.
  • Provide expert guidance and support to development teams on best practices for environment management and release processes.
  • Enhance CI/CD pipelines and support software build and deployment activities.
  • Support BAU team with application monitoring and issue resolution.
  • Ensure environment security compliance and identify vulnerabilities.
  • Drive continuous improvement in the release process.
  • Perform work in a manner that complies with relevant regulatory standards including Work Health & Safety (WHS) legislation.

Essentials

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field, or equivalent industry experience.
  • 3- 5 years of experience in environment and release management
  • Strong understanding of environment management, maintenance, and complex large-scale releases.
  • Experience with ITIL, including Change Management, Incident Management, and Problem Management.
  • Experience in Release Management Industry Best Practise Processes and guidelines.
  • Microsoft Azure DevOps or GitHub knowledge for release branch and automated code deployment across multiple streams.
  • Previous IT experience across multiple technologies and platforms.
  • Proficiency in CI/CD processes and tools.
  • Strong people skills, problem-solving, coordination, and communication skills.
  • Ability to work collaboratively in a team environment.
  • Ability to work autonomously.

Desirable (Any two)

  • Experience in coordinating complex environment usage and alignment, managing endpoints, and ensuring environment stability and availability.
  • Previous experience working with in Health/Health Insurance Industry.
  • Proven track record in managing build and deployments, supporting deployment/release activities end-to-end.
  • Ability to identify process & guideline improvements for ongoing uplift and maturity.
  • Proficiency in scripting and updating build and deployments, running jobs in environments, and compliance and remediation of security vulnerabilities.
  • Foundational knowledge of AWS and Azure products.
